The highlight of yesterday was having breakfast at Goofy's kitchen. It was an early birthday present to William. He loved it. Without doubt the most expensive breakfast I've ever been a party to. When the waiter asked what we wanted to drink, I asked for a cappuccino. Waiter's response: "that will be extra." I genuinely thought he was joking. He wasn't, and Lara and I settled for an OJ. 





They also scammed nearly 30 bucks (US) out of us for a photo opportunity. Add a compulsory 20% gratuity to the total bill and Phil's in need of a couple of high paying briefs on his return. The food was unbelievable. Perfect if you are 400 kg's. Otherwise, too hard to really make a dint. The kids loved it. William (did I mention he's back on sugar?) started with with a soft serve. There was also Goofy's famous peanut butter and Jelly pizza (and any other flavour you wanted). You name it, they had it. Desserts, savoury, mac & cheese, hot dogs, M&M's, fried chicken nuggets, snakes, fruit loops, LCM bars dipped in chocolate, Orio choc Mouse, bread & butter pudding, creme brûlée and cake pops just to give you a basic overview. Your standard breakfast dining fare really. 

Kids also loved being stuck on Space Mountain yesterday. Mid-ride the entire ride was shut down. We sat in the dark until rescued by employees who ended up pushing us the remainder of the way. Turns out that some poor coot had a seizure or heart attack or something. Possibly as a result of dining with Goofy?!

Last night we went to the Disney light show at Cali Adventure Park. Lights, colour and lots of water and fire shooting everywhere. Disney movie characters were projected onto the water as well. It was ace. Home for a 10.00 pm bed time.
